PC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S union (wdm.h)
PC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S结构描述了 PCI Express (PCIe) PCIe 高级错误报告功能结构的辅助不可更正错误状态寄存器。
语法
typedef union _PC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S {
struct {
ULONG TargetAbortOnSplitCompletion :1;
ULONG MasterAbortOnSplitCompletion :1;
ULONG ReceivedTargetAbort :1;
ULONG ReceivedMasterAbort :1;
ULONG RsvdZ :1;
ULONG UnexpectedSplitCompletionError :1;
ULONG UncorrectableSplitCompletion :1;
ULONG UncorrectableDataError :1;
ULONG UncorrectableAttributeError :1;
ULONG UncorrectableAddressError :1;
ULONG DelayedTransactionDiscardTimerExpired :1;
ULONG PERRAsserted :1;
ULONG SERRAsserted :1;
ULONG InternalBridgeError :1;
ULONG Reserved :18;
};
ULONG AsULONG;
} PC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S, *PPC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S;
成员
DUMMYSTRUCTNAME
DUMMYSTRUCTNAME.TargetAbortOnSplitCompletion
一个位,指示在拆分完成时发生目标中止。
DUMMYSTRUCTNAME.MasterAbortOnSplitCompletion
一个位,指示在拆分完成时发生主节点中止。
DUMMYSTRUCTNAME.ReceivedTargetAbort
指示已收到目标中止的单个位。
DUMMYSTRUCTNAME.ReceivedMasterAbort
指示已收到主中止的单个位。
DUMMYSTRUCTNAME.RsvdZ
预留给系统使用。
DUMMYSTRUCTNAME.UnexpectedSplitCompletionError
一个位,指示发生了意外的拆分完成错误。
DUMMYSTRUCTNAME.UncorrectableSplitCompletion
一个位,指示发生了无法更正的拆分完成消息数据错误。
DUMMYSTRUCTNAME.UncorrectableDataError
一个位,指示发生了不可更正的数据错误。
DUMMYSTRUCTNAME.UncorrectableAttributeError
一个位,指示发生了不可更正的属性错误。
DUMMYSTRUCTNAME.UncorrectableAddressError
一个位,指示发生了无法更正的地址错误。
DUMMYSTRUCTNAME.DelayedTransactionDiscardTimerExpired
指示延迟事务放弃计时器已过期的单个位。
DUMMYSTRUCTNAME.PERRAsserted
指示检测到 PERR# 断言的单个位。
DUMMYSTRUCTNAME.SERRAsserted
指示检测到 SERR# 断言的单个位。
DUMMYSTRUCTNAME.InternalBridgeError
指示发生了内部网桥错误的单个位。
DUMMYSTRUCTNAME.Reserved
预留给系统使用。
AsULONG
PC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S 结构内容的 ULONG 表示形式。
注解
PC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S结构在 Windows Server 2008 及更高版本的 Windows 中可用。
PCI_EXPRESS_BRIDGE_AER_CAPABILITY 结构中包含 PCI_EXPRESS_SEC_UNCORRECTABLE_ERROR_STATUS 结构。
要求
要求 | 值 |
---|---|
Header | wdm.h (包括 Ntddk.h、Wdm.h、Miniport.h) |
另请参阅
反馈
https://aka.ms/ContentUserFeedback。
即将发布:在整个 2024 年,我们将逐步淘汰作为内容反馈机制的“GitHub 问题”,并将其取代为新的反馈系统。 有关详细信息,请参阅:提交和查看相关反馈